Oracle基础教程:从入门到实践

需积分: 9 0 下载量 42 浏览量 更新于2024-07-23 收藏 2.7MB PDF 举报
"Oracle经典教程" 这是一份专为初学者设计的Oracle入门教程,旨在在一个小时内提供Oracle基础知识的快速通识。教程覆盖了Oracle数据库的基础知识,包括Oracle的简介、安装步骤、客户端工具、服务管理、用户与权限设置等内容,同时深入讲解了SQL数据操作和查询、子查询和常用函数、数据库对象(如表空间、同义词、序列、视图和索引)、PL/SQL程序设计以及Oracle在.Net平台的应用,还有数据库的导入导出操作。 1. **Oracle简介**:Oracle是一种基于对象的关系型数据库管理系统,它扩展了传统的关系型数据库概念,支持对象存储,提供了更丰富的数据类型和更强大的数据管理功能。教程会介绍Oracle的基本架构和核心概念。 2. **Oracle安装**:这部分将指导读者如何在计算机上安装Oracle数据库,包括所需的硬件和软件配置、安装过程和配置步骤。 3. **Oracle客户端工具**:介绍用于连接和管理Oracle数据库的各种工具,如SQL*Plus、Oracle SQL Developer等,以及如何使用它们来执行查询和管理数据库。 4. **Oracle服务**:讲解如何启动、关闭Oracle服务,以及理解Oracle后台进程的重要性。 5. **Oracle用户和权限**:讨论Oracle中的用户管理,包括创建用户、分配权限和角色,以及权限的管理和控制。 6. **SQL数据操作和查询**:涵盖SQL语言的基础,包括数据类型、表的创建、DML(INSERT, UPDATE, DELETE)操作,以及基本查询语法。 7. **子查询和常用函数**:深入到更复杂的SQL查询技术,如子查询和Oracle特有的伪列,以及各种内置函数的使用。 8. **数据库对象**:介绍Oracle中的关键数据库对象,如表、同义词、序列、视图和索引,以及如何创建和管理这些对象。 9. **PL/SQL程序设计**:讲解Oracle的PL/SQL编程语言,包括其基本结构、数据类型、流程控制和异常处理。 10. **Oracle应用于.Net平台**:展示了如何在.Net环境中使用Oracle,包括ADO.NET的使用和Oracle连接的实现。 11. **数据库导入导出**:涵盖Oracle的数据迁移工具,如EXP和IMP,以及常见的数据导入导出问题和解决方案。 通过这个教程,初学者可以快速建立起对Oracle数据库系统的理解,掌握基本的数据库管理和开发技能,为进一步的学习和实践打下坚实基础。每个章节末尾的总结和练习题旨在巩固所学知识,帮助学习者更好地理解和应用Oracle的相关概念。